Candidates should possess a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, BIS, CIS, Electrical Engineering, or Operations Research, with coursework or experience in Numerical Analysis, Mathematics, or Statistics being a plus. They must have at least 5-8 years of experience as a data engineer, proficiency in using the Spark framework (Python or Scala), extensive knowledge of Data Warehousing concepts, and programming experience in Python, SQL, and Scala. Hands-on experience with building data pipelines using Apache Spark (preferably in Databricks) and Airflow, designing and delivering solutions using Azure, including Azure Storage, Azure SQL Data Warehouse, and Azure Data Lake, is required. Experience with big data technologies (Hadoop) and Databricks & Azure Big Data Architecture Certification is preferred.
The Data Engineer will be responsible for assembling large, complex sets of data to meet business requirements, identifying and implementing internal process improvements, including infrastructure re-design and automation. They will build required infrastructure for data extraction, transformation, and loading from various sources using Azure, Databricks, and SQL technologies, transform R&D algorithms into production-ready code, integrate finished models into larger data processes using UNIX scripting languages, produce and maintain documentation for released data sets and programs, and ensure quality deliverables to clients by following quality processes and visually inspecting data for reasonableness.

Nielsen provides measurement and data analytics services to help businesses understand consumers and markets globally. The company operates through two main divisions: Nielsen Global Media, which offers reliable metrics for the media and advertising industries, and Nielsen Global Connect, which supplies consumer packaged goods manufacturers and retailers with actionable insights about the marketplace. Nielsen combines its proprietary data with other sources to give clients a comprehensive view of current trends and future opportunities. With a presence in over 100 countries, Nielsen aims to support companies in making informed decisions to drive innovation and growth.
